Biography:

Chris Chocola grew up in Michigan, graduating from Williamston High School in 1980. He graduated from Hillsdale College in Hillsdale, Mich., in 1984 with a double major in business administration and political economy.

He was recruited for the management training program with Society National Bank, now known as KeyBank, in Cleveland, Ohio in 1984, and was serving as a foreign exchange trader when he left to attend Thomas Cooley Law School in Lansing, Mich.

After graduating in 1988, Chocola joined CTB International Corp. in Milford, Ind., a producer of equipment for poultry, hog and grain industries that his grandfather founded. He initially managed all the legal aspects of the business as corporate counsel and was named chief executive officer in 1994 and became chairman of the board in 1999.

In 2002 he oversaw the sale of the the company to Berkshire Hathaway Inc., the investment firm of billionaire Warren Buffett.

Chocola and his wife, Sarah, live in Bristol, Ind., where they are raising their two children.


Past Campaigns:

In 2000, Chris Chocola mounted a bigger challenge than many political observers expected against five-term incumbent Rep. Tim Roemer, spending nearly twice as much as Roemer.

He received 47 percent of the vote, compared to Roemer's 52 percent. In 2002, after Roemer decided not to run again, Chocola defeated Democrat Jill Long Thompson to win his first U.S. House seat.
